Adventures in Malaysia: A Family Friendly 7-Day Itinerary

Friday, December 1: Exploring Kuala Lumpur

Morning: Start your adventure in the heart of Kuala Lumpur at Petronas Twin Towers. Marvel at the stunning views of the city from the observation deck. Afternoon: Visit Merdeka Square, the historical landmark where Malaysia declared independence. Take a stroll to Central Market for some local shopping. Evening: Enjoy a traditional Malay dinner at Jalan Alor, known for its vibrant street food.

  • Petronas Twin Towers: Estimated Cost: Free (Observation deck tickets: $10-$25), Time Spent: 2-3 hours
  • Merdeka Square: Estimated Cost: Free, Time Spent: 1-2 hours
  • Central Market: Estimated Cost: Varies, Time Spent: 1-2 hours
  • Jalan Alor: Estimated Cost: Varies, Time Spent: 2-3 hours
Saturday, December 2: Historical Melaka

Morning: Take a drive to Melaka, a UNESCO World Heritage Site. Explore the historical landmarks, such as A Famosa fortress and St. Paul's Church. Afternoon: Discover Jonker Street, famous for its antique shops and vibrant cultural scene. Evening: Enjoy a picturesque sunset boat ride along the Melaka River.

  • A Famosa: Estimated Cost: Free, Time Spent: 1-2 hours
  • St. Paul's Church: Estimated Cost: Free, Time Spent: 1 hour
  • Jonker Street: Estimated Cost: Varies, Time Spent: 2-3 hours
  • Melaka River Boat Ride: Estimated Cost: $5-$10, Time Spent: 1 hour
Sunday, December 3: Nature Adventure in Taman Negara National Park

Morning: Travel to Taman Negara National Park, one of the oldest rainforests in the world. Embark on a guided jungle trek to spot diverse wildlife. Afternoon: Experience the Canopy Walk, a thrilling walkway suspended high above the treetops. Evening: Relax by the riverside and witness a magical firefly display.

  • Guided Jungle Trek: Estimated Cost: $30-$50, Time Spent: 4-5 hours
  • Canopy Walk: Estimated Cost: $5-$10, Time Spent: 1-2 hours
  • Firefly Tour: Estimated Cost: $10-$20, Time Spent: 1-2 hours
Monday, December 4: Cultural Heritage in Georgetown, Penang

Morning: Fly to Penang and head to Georgetown, a UNESCO World Heritage Site. Explore the cultural heritage sites, including Fort Cornwallis and Khoo Kongsi clan house. Afternoon: Visit the vibrant street art scene and enjoy local delicacies at Penang Hawker Food Stalls. Evening: Indulge in a trishaw ride through the historic streets of Georgetown.

  • Fort Cornwallis: Estimated Cost: $2-$4, Time Spent: 1-2 hours
  • Khoo Kongsi: Estimated Cost: $5-$10, Time Spent: 1-2 hours
  • Penang Hawker Food Stalls: Estimated Cost: Varies, Time Spent: 2-3 hours
  • Trishaw Ride: Estimated Cost: $5-$10, Time Spent: 1 hour
Tuesday, December 5: Sun, Sand, and Sea in Langkawi

Morning: Fly to Langkawi, a tropical paradise with stunning beaches. Relax on the pristine shores of Pantai Cenang. Afternoon: Explore the fascinating underwater world at the Langkawi Underwater World. Evening: Experience the iconic Langkawi Cable Car and witness the breathtaking views from the Sky Bridge.

  • Pantai Cenang: Estimated Cost: Free, Time Spent: Relaxation
  • Langkawi Underwater World: Estimated Cost: $10-$15, Time Spent: 2-3 hours
  • Langkawi Cable Car and Sky Bridge: Estimated Cost: $10-$20, Time Spent: 2-3 hours
Wednesday, December 6: Jungle Adventures in Borneo

Morning: Fly to Borneo and head to the Sepilok Orangutan Rehabilitation Centre. Witness these incredible creatures in their natural habitat. Afternoon: Explore the mystical Gomantong Caves, known for its unique ecosystem. Evening: Take a night safari in Kinabatangan Wildlife Sanctuary and spot rare wildlife.

  • Sepilok Orangutan Rehabilitation Centre: Estimated Cost: $10-$20, Time Spent: 2-3 hours
  • Gomantong Caves: Estimated Cost: $5-$10, Time Spent: 1-2 hours
  • Kinabatangan Wildlife Sanctuary: Estimated Cost: $20-$40, Time Spent: 4-6 hours
Thursday, December 7: Island Paradise in Perhentian Islands

Morning: Fly to Kota Bharu and take a boat to the stunning Perhentian Islands. Spend the day snorkeling in crystal-clear waters and relaxing on white sandy beaches. Afternoon: Explore the vibrant marine life with a scuba diving session. Evening: Enjoy a beachside barbecue dinner under the starry night sky.

  • Snorkeling: Estimated Cost: $10-$20, Time Spent: 1-2 hours
  • Scuba Diving: Estimated Cost: $50-$100, Time Spent: 2-3 hours
  • Beachside Barbecue Dinner: Estimated Cost: $15-$25, Time Spent: 2-3 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For an off the beaten path experience, head to the charming town of Kundasang in Sabah. Explore the scenic Kundasang War Memorial and take in breathtaking views of Mount Kinabalu. Don't miss the opportunity to visit the Desa Dairy Farm, where you can experience feeding cows and enjoy fresh dairy products. This family-friendly destination offers a unique blend of nature and cultural heritage.
